From: Baokun Li <libaokun@huaweicloud.com>
To: Jingbo Xu <jefflexu@linux.alibaba.com>,
	netfs@lists.linux.dev, dhowells@redhat.com, jlayton@kernel.org
Cc: hsiangkao@linux.alibaba.com, zhujia.zj@bytedance.com,
	linux-erofs@lists.ozlabs.org, linux-fsdevel@vger.kernel.org,
	linux-kernel@vger.kernel.org, yangerkun@huawei.com,
	houtao1@huawei.com, yukuai3@huawei.com, wozizhi@huawei.com,
	Baokun Li <libaokun1@huawei.com>,
	libaokun@huaweicloud.com
Subject: Re: [PATCH v2 05/12] cachefiles: add output string to cachefiles_obj_[get|put]_ondemand_fd
Date: Mon, 20 May 2024 17:02:31 +0800	[thread overview]
Message-ID: <f933cc64-970d-7be5-8409-f96122254eda@huaweicloud.com> (raw)
In-Reply-To: <af4b9591-d82e-4da3-b681-eb677369ced3@linux.alibaba.com>
On 2024/5/20 15:40, Jingbo Xu wrote:
>
> On 5/15/24 4:45 PM, libaokun@huaweicloud.com wrote:
>> From: Baokun Li <libaokun1@huawei.com>
>>
>> This lets us see the correct trace output.
>>
>> Fixes: c8383054506c ("cachefiles: notify the user daemon when looking up cookie")
>> Signed-off-by: Baokun Li <libaokun1@huawei.com>
>
> Could we move this simple fix to the beginning of the patch set?
>
> Reviewed-by: Jingbo Xu <jefflexu@linux.alibaba.com>
>
Thanks for the review!
This patch is here because when adding trace-related output in the
last patch (path 4), it was found that cachefiles_obj_[get|put]_ondemand_fd
did not have any relevant trace output, so it is added in this patch.
Putting it in the first patch may confuse the reader as to why it was
added, but it is easier to understand with cachefiles_obj_[get|put]_read_req
in front of it.
>> ---
>>   include/trace/events/cachefiles.h | 2 ++
>>   1 file changed, 2 insertions(+)
>>
>> diff --git a/include/trace/events/cachefiles.h b/include/trace/events/cachefiles.h
>> index 119a823fb5a0..bb56e3104b12 100644
>> --- a/include/trace/events/cachefiles.h
>> +++ b/include/trace/events/cachefiles.h
>> @@ -130,6 +130,8 @@ enum cachefiles_error_trace {
>>   	EM(cachefiles_obj_see_lookup_failed,	"SEE lookup_failed")	\
>>   	EM(cachefiles_obj_see_withdraw_cookie,	"SEE withdraw_cookie")	\
>>   	EM(cachefiles_obj_see_withdrawal,	"SEE withdrawal")	\
>> +	EM(cachefiles_obj_get_ondemand_fd,      "GET ondemand_fd")      \
>> +	EM(cachefiles_obj_put_ondemand_fd,      "PUT ondemand_fd")      \
>>   	EM(cachefiles_obj_get_read_req,		"GET read_req")		\
>>   	E_(cachefiles_obj_put_read_req,		"PUT read_req")
>>   
-- 
With Best Regards,
Baokun Li
next prev parent reply	other threads:[~2024-05-20  9:02 UTC|newest]
Thread overview: 38+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2024-05-15  8:45 [PATCH v2 00/12] cachefiles: some bugfixes and cleanups for ondemand requests libaokun
2024-05-15  8:45 ` [PATCH v2 01/12] cachefiles: remove request from xarry during flush requests libaokun
2024-05-20  2:20   ` Gao Xiang
2024-05-20  4:11     ` Baokun Li
2024-05-20  7:09   ` Jingbo Xu
2024-05-15  8:45 ` [PATCH v2 02/12] cachefiles: remove err_put_fd tag in cachefiles_ondemand_daemon_read() libaokun
2024-05-20  2:23   ` Gao Xiang
2024-05-20  4:15     ` Baokun Li
2024-05-15  8:45 ` [PATCH v2 03/12] cachefiles: fix slab-use-after-free in cachefiles_ondemand_get_fd() libaokun
2024-05-20  7:24   ` Jingbo Xu
2024-05-20  8:38     ` Baokun Li
2024-05-20  8:45       ` Gao Xiang
2024-05-20  9:10       ` Jingbo Xu
2024-05-20  9:19         ` Baokun Li
2024-05-20 12:22         ` Baokun Li
2024-05-20  8:06   ` Jingbo Xu
2024-05-20  9:10     ` Baokun Li
2024-05-15  8:45 ` [PATCH v2 04/12] cachefiles: fix slab-use-after-free in cachefiles_ondemand_daemon_read() libaokun
2024-05-20  7:36   ` Jingbo Xu
2024-05-20  8:56     ` Baokun Li
2024-05-15  8:45 ` [PATCH v2 05/12] cachefiles: add output string to cachefiles_obj_[get|put]_ondemand_fd libaokun
2024-05-20  7:40   ` Jingbo Xu
2024-05-20  9:02     ` Baokun Li [this message]
2024-05-15  8:45 ` [PATCH v2 06/12] cachefiles: add consistency check for copen/cread libaokun
2024-05-15  8:45 ` [PATCH v2 07/12] cachefiles: add spin_lock for cachefiles_ondemand_info libaokun
2024-05-15  8:45 ` [PATCH v2 08/12] cachefiles: never get a new anonymous fd if ondemand_id is valid libaokun
2024-05-20  8:43   ` Jingbo Xu
2024-05-20  9:07     ` Baokun Li
2024-05-20  9:24       ` Jingbo Xu
2024-05-20 11:14         ` Baokun Li
2024-05-20 11:24           ` Gao Xiang
2024-05-15  8:45 ` [PATCH v2 09/12] cachefiles: defer exposing anon_fd until after copy_to_user() succeeds libaokun
2024-05-20  9:39   ` Jingbo Xu
2024-05-20 11:36     ` Baokun Li
2024-05-15  8:45 ` [PATCH v2 10/12] cachefiles: Set object to close if ondemand_id < 0 in copen libaokun
2024-05-15  8:46 ` [PATCH v2 11/12] cachefiles: flush all requests after setting CACHEFILES_DEAD libaokun
2024-05-15  8:46 ` [PATCH v2 12/12] cachefiles: make on-demand read killable libaokun
2024-05-19 10:56 ` [PATCH v2 00/12] cachefiles: some bugfixes and cleanups for ondemand requests Jeff Layton
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ox
  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):
  git send-email \
    --in-reply-to=f933cc64-970d-7be5-8409-f96122254eda@huaweicloud.com \
    --to=libaokun@huaweicloud.com \
    --cc=dhowells@redhat.com \
    --cc=houtao1@huawei.com \
    --cc=hsiangkao@linux.alibaba.com \
    --cc=jefflexu@linux.alibaba.com \
    --cc=jlayton@kernel.org \
    --cc=libaokun1@huawei.com \
    --cc=linux-erofs@lists.ozlabs.org \
    --cc=linux-fsdevel@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=netfs@lists.linux.dev \
    --cc=wozizhi@huawei.com \
    --cc=yangerkun@huawei.com \
    --cc=yukuai3@huawei.com \
    --cc=zhujia.zj@bytedance.com \
    /path/to/YOUR_REPLY
  https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
  Be sure your reply has a Subject: header at the top and a blank line
  before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).